What does Ceramide Eop do in a cosmetic formula?
This ingredient is a skin-identical conditioning lipid used to support the skin barrier and reduce water loss. It is typically included in moisturizers, serums, and barrier creams as part of a lipid blend rather than as a stand-alone active.
Is Ceramide Eop clean?
From a clean-beauty perspective, this ingredient is generally well-tolerated, low-sensitizing, and not a common restricted-list concern. The main watchpoint is origin and manufacturing route, since commercial grades can be synthetic, fermentation-derived, or plant-derived.
Is Ceramide Eop sustainable?
This material is used at very low levels, so formula-level footprint is usually small. Sustainability depends on feedstock and process, with fermentation or plant-derived supply generally aligning better than petrochemical-heavy synthesis.
Is Ceramide Eop COSMOS-approved?
This ingredient may be compatible with COSMOS-natural when the feedstocks and processing steps meet the standard, but not every commercial grade qualifies. Its Green Chemistry profile is strongest when made from renewable inputs with efficient processing and good biodegradability for the finished lipid.
How does Ceramide Eop work chemically?
The molecule is a long-chain sphingolipid built from a phytosphingoid base linked to an omega-hydroxy fatty acid that is further esterified with a fatty acid, giving it strong lamellar-barrier behavior. It is commonly used around 0.001% to 0.1%, often with cholesterol and free fatty acids, and it needs careful dispersion because it has very low water solubility.
